Category by category

Display
Narzo 80 Pro 5G 80Galaxy A15 5G 50

The Narzo 80 Pro 5G's screen is the better one — 6.72-inch oled, 120hz, 4500 nits peak.

Performance
Narzo 80 Pro 5G 62Galaxy A15 5G 38

The Narzo 80 Pro 5G's MediaTek Dimensity 7400 (4nm) is simply the faster chip.

Camera
Narzo 80 Pro 5G 55Galaxy A15 5G 55

Camera systems are comparable on paper — pick by sample photos.

Battery
Narzo 80 Pro 5G 100Galaxy A15 5G 80

6,000mAh vs 5,000mAh — the Narzo 80 Pro 5G lasts longer between charges.

Software longevity
Narzo 80 Pro 5G 26Galaxy A15 5G 36

The Galaxy A15 5G is supported until Dec 2028 — 8 months longer than the Narzo 80 Pro 5G.

Full spec table
SpecNarzo 80 Pro 5GGalaxy A15 5G
Price (street)$235$120
Display6.72-inch OLED, 120Hz, 4500 nits peak6.5-inch Super AMOLED, 1080x2340 (FHD+), 90Hz
ChipsetMediaTek Dimensity 7400 (4nm)Dimensity 6100+
RAM8GB/12GB4GB/6GB/8GB
Storage128GB/256GB128GB/256GB
Battery6,000 mAh5,000 mAh
Charging80W wired25W wired
Rear cameras50MP main50MP main, 5MP ultra-wide, 2MP macro
Dimensions162.8 × 74.9 × 7.6 mm160.1 × 76.8 × 8.4 mm
Weight179 g200 g
Water resistanceIP69 (also IP68)None
Supported untilApr 2028Dec 2028
